So the mechanic called me today and said that he is having a hard time figuring out if I have the 18mm or 20mm dowels. He doesnt want to order the wrong parts. I figured that since I have an 07 they would be 20mm but he said some do and some dont, therefore we are in a predicament. I say order both and send the ones back that he doesnt use but ford doesnt see it that way I guess. He figured it out. If you have the non flexable oil return tube on the turbo and the one piece intake tube from the air cleaner to the turbo you have the 20mm dowels, I have the 20mm dowels.

They were the 20mm ones. I checked it out last night since he had the heads off yet and low and behold the gaskets were blown. I had a feeling that the 2 radiator caps and the degas bottle would not fix it. At least its getting done right now. I watched him straight edge my heads and there was one spot on both heads that he could squeeze 1½ thousands feeler gauge under but not all the way through, it was no where near where the gaskets blew. The heads are back on and the oil cooler and STC fitting get changed today. Then the daunting task of putting it all back together.
